ELECTRONIC CONTROL DEVICE Russian patent published in 2024 - IPC H03K17/96 

Abstract RU 2813537 C1

FIELD: refrigerating or freezing equipment; electronic circuits.

SUBSTANCE: invention relates to electronic control devices, which can be designed for refrigerating devices, such as vending machines, refrigerated display cases for bottled beverages and freezer counters. Present invention discloses an electronic control device (10) comprising electronic circuit (11), which is characterized by the presence of working surface (11a) on which a plurality of light-emitting diodes (12) are mounted; housing (13), which defines a plurality of first channels (14) facing the LEDs for setting the direction of their light emission; and composite screen (15), which closes first channels (14) so that it is crossed by light radiation emitted by light-emitting diodes (12) and directed by first channels (14) towards composite screen (15). Electronic control device (10) further comprises at least one connector (20), which electrically connects connecting contacts (19) to the electronic circuit for transmitting electrical signals to it after the user touches at least one of said touch contact pads (18) on composite screen (15).

EFFECT: invention enables to simplify production, personalization, and control of an electronic device.
